AWO Services During COVID-19 Pandemic
The rapidly changing situation and conditions due to the COVID-19 (coronavirus) pandemic have resulted in the AWO Refugee and Immigrant Service suspending all in-person services.
AWO’s highest priority is to protect the health and well-being of our clients, staff, and the wider community. Therefore, our main locations and itinerant location services will be closed until further notice.
Temporarily suspended programming includes:
- In-person appointments;
- LINC (Language Instruction for Newcomers to Canada) classes;
- Information sessions, workshops, and all in-person/group programming; and
- Income Tax Clinics
Settlement workers will be working remotely to serve you via the phone and online.
